One type of solar panel that is gaining traction in the United States is solar film panels. Unlike traditional solar panels, which are made up of silicon cells, solar film panels are made of thin film materials such as cadmium telluride or amorphous silicon. These thin film materials are more flexible, lightweight, and have the potential to be more affordable than traditional silicon solar panels.

There are several benefits to using solar film panels. One of the biggest advantages is their flexibility. Solar film panels can be easily installed on curved surfaces and can even be integrated into building materials such as windows or roofing tiles. This makes them ideal for buildings with limited roof space or unconventional shapes.

Another benefit of solar film panels is their lightweight construction. Traditional solar panels can be heavy and cumbersome, making them difficult to install on certain structures. Solar film panels, on the other hand, are much lighter and easier to handle, making installation a breeze.

Solar film panels are also more aesthetically pleasing than traditional solar panels. Because they are thin and flexible, they can be seamlessly integrated into a building's design without sticking out like a sore thumb. This is particularly appealing for homeowners who want to add solar panels to their homes without sacrificing the aesthetic appeal of their property.

In terms of performance, solar film panels are quite efficient at converting sunlight into electricity. While they may not be as efficient as traditional silicon solar panels, they still have the ability to generate a significant amount of clean, renewable energy. When installed properly, solar film panels can help reduce a building's reliance on traditional energy sources and lower utility bills.
